  • Q1. What is rectifier? what are the different types of rectifier??
  • Ans. 

    A rectifier is an electrical device that converts alternating current (AC) to direct current (DC). There are different types of rectifiers including half-wave, full-wave, and bridge rectifiers.

    • Rectifier is used to convert AC to DC by allowing current to flow in only one direction.

    • Half-wave rectifier only allows one half of the AC waveform to pass through.

    • Full-wave rectifier allows both halves of the AC waveform to pass...

  • Q2. What is flip flop? what are the different types of flip flop? Draw circuit diagram and truth table for JK flip flop
  • Ans. 

    A flip flop is a digital circuit that stores a single bit of data. There are different types of flip flops such as SR, D, JK, and T flip flops.

    • Flip flop is a sequential logic circuit that stores one bit of data.

    • Types of flip flops include SR, D, JK, and T flip flops.

    • JK flip flop has two inputs (J and K), a clock input, and two outputs (Q and Q').

    • The truth table for a JK flip flop shows the behavior of the flip flop bas

  • Q4. In an Array of size 95 contain numbers in range 1 to 100. each number is at max once in the array. find the 5 missing numbers in array between 1-100
  • Ans. 

    Find 5 missing numbers in an array of size 95 containing numbers in range 1 to 100.

    • Create a boolean array of size 100 and mark the present numbers

    • Iterate through the boolean array and find the missing numbers

    • Alternatively, use a HashSet to store the present numbers and find the missing ones
